Output 7efa56099ed0cc02a3a189df370c79bec4037ff68c565c2c1adfeb9214088da2:47

value
17284452
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dff9e8394d7003b137ca1e2e3408ab771595b91d OP_EQUALVERIFY OP_CHECKSIG
address
1MRH4dWxDTJEzoKZgwozq1qFcGwfx6B1cc
transaction
7efa56099ed0cc02a3a189df370c79bec4037ff68c565c2c1adfeb9214088da2
spent
true